Streetvibe Young Peoples Services (syps) Limited
Also known as: Streetvibe Young People's Service
Streetvibe is a service that uses informal educational methods to engage with young people, offering them someone to talk too, somewhere to go and something to get involved with. All of Streetvibe's services are aimed at young people's voluntary engagement and are open to all. Most of the engagement with young people is through both structured and unstructured group work sessions.
